I have to admit that I was surprised when my Valentine’s Day picture book became my best selling book.  It has sold well every year since it was first published.  

 

As I’ve researched just why this book seems to be so popular, I became aware of the dearth of Valentine’s books with references to God and His word.  Clearly, there is a need for such books.

 

In light of that, I decided a sequel is in order.  So, next year at this time “God Sent Me a Valentine” will hopefully have been published. 

The format will be the same - a rhyming story with Scripture references citing the New Living Translation.  I find this translation to be an easily understood, even by the youngest of children.

 

The message will be similar to “I Sent God a Valentine” - that God Himself is love, and the source of true love in our world.  I’m excited to start on this new venture and will keep you all updated.
